HISTOIRE
It is most likely that the Bluetick is principally descended from the quick foxhounds of England with some introduction of the blood of various French hounds. Blueticks were originally registered with UKC as English. In 1946, at the request of the Bluetick fanciers, UKC began registering Blueticks as a separate breed.
